Appendix B - Default Settings Media Settings (Continued) Setting Description Default Clip Default Start Adjust Stop Adjust Media Calibration Mode Length (Slow Mode) LTS Sensitivity Level Determines if the printer prints items Off outside the printable area of the label. When this is set to Off, the printer returns an error if any part of a bar code label cannot be printed because that part extends beyond the printable area. When this is set to On, the printer prints all bar code labels, but may also print unreadable, incomplete labels. Sets the length of media the printer feeds 0 (positive value) or retracts (negative value) before printing a label. Unit of measurement is defined in the Unit of Measure parameter. Range is -9999 to +9999. Sets the length of media the printer feeds 0 (positive value) or retracts (negative value) after printing a label. Unit of measurement is defined in the Unit of Measure parameter. Range is -9999 to +9999. Selects the mode the printer uses to Fast calibrate media. Use Slow if the printer has trouble identifying gaps or marks in media. If Media Calibration Mode is set to Slow, 0 the printer prints the media length plus 10 mm. This value sets an additional amount of media to be printed. Unit of measurement is defined in the Unit of Measurement parameter. Range is 0 to 3200. Sets the sensitivity of the label taken sensor. 0 Range is 0 to 14. Supported when the Cutter or Label Dispenser accessories are installed. 138 PM23c, PM43, and PM43c Mid-Range Printer User Manual
